Major construction firms and private building companies have been taking full advantage of the Barbados National Standards Institution’s (BNSI) Compression Testing capabilities.

Word of this has come from the Chief Technical Officer, Haydn Rhynd, who said that on a daily basis, testing was carried out on concrete blocks, cubes and other materials used in the building industry in the BNSI’s soil and testing materials laboratory.         

He made these disclosures to the media following a tour of its Culloden Road, St. Michael, administrative office and laboratories, by Minister of Economic Affairs and Empowerment, Innovation, Trade, Industry and Commerce, Dr. David Estwick and other officials.

He said the paid service was also available to members of the public. “It is not just for large industries, we also take requests from the public. So, you can come into the laboratory and bring your cubes and your blocks and we will expedite the process for you.”
